Key Trends Shaping the OSC Steel Industry in 2025
Alright, now let’s get to the fun part – the trends that will be shaping the OSC steel industry in 2025. The steel industry is undergoing a significant transformation driven by various factors, including technology, sustainability, and market demands. So, what can we expect? For starters, sustainability is going to be HUGE. Governments and consumers alike are pushing for greener practices, meaning steel manufacturers will need to invest in cleaner production methods. Think electric arc furnaces, carbon capture technologies, and using more recycled materials. Companies that can demonstrate a commitment to sustainability will definitely have an advantage. The increasing demand for green steel, produced with minimal environmental impact, is driving innovation and investment in new technologies.
Digitalization is another massive trend. We’re talking about implementing Industry 4.0 technologies to boost efficiency and productivity. Expect to see more AI-powered systems optimizing production lines, predictive maintenance reducing downtime, and advanced data analytics providing insights for better decision-making. Companies that fully embrace digitalization will be able to respond faster to market changes and operate more efficiently. Also, don't forget about additive manufacturing, or 3D printing, which is gaining traction in the steel industry. This technology allows for the creation of complex steel components with minimal waste, opening up new possibilities for product design and customization. The integration of digital platforms for supply chain management will also be critical, enabling better coordination and transparency across the value chain.
Finally, the rise of smart steel is something to watch. Smart steel incorporates sensors and embedded technologies to monitor structural health, detect corrosion, and provide real-time data on performance. This is particularly valuable in infrastructure projects, where safety and durability are paramount. The development and adoption of smart steel will enhance the lifespan and reliability of structures, while also reducing maintenance costs.
Opportunities and Challenges for the OSC Steel Industry
So, with all these changes happening, what opportunities and challenges are on the horizon for the OSC steel industry? On the opportunity side, there’s plenty to be excited about! The growing demand for infrastructure in developing countries presents a huge market for steel. Governments worldwide are investing in roads, bridges, railways, and buildings, creating a sustained need for steel products. This is especially true in emerging economies where urbanization and industrialization are driving rapid growth. Also, the shift towards renewable energy offers new avenues for steel consumption. Solar, wind, and hydroelectric projects require significant amounts of steel, offering a boost to the industry. Furthermore, the automotive industry’s transition to electric vehicles (EVs) is creating opportunities for specialized steel products that are lightweight and high-strength. These steels are essential for improving the efficiency and safety of EVs.
However, it’s not all sunshine and rainbows. The industry also faces some significant challenges. Fluctuations in raw material prices can really throw a wrench in things. Iron ore, coal, and other inputs can be highly volatile, impacting the profitability of steelmakers. Managing these price risks is crucial for maintaining competitiveness. Moreover, trade tensions and protectionist measures can disrupt global steel markets, leading to uncertainty and reduced export opportunities. Steel companies need to navigate these geopolitical complexities carefully to minimize the impact on their operations. In addition, environmental regulations are becoming stricter, requiring substantial investments in cleaner technologies. Meeting these requirements can be costly, especially for smaller companies. Finally, competition from other materials, such as aluminum and composites, poses a threat to steel’s market share. Steel companies need to innovate and develop new products to maintain their position in the market.
